Quick Summary
Wasteland 2 is a full retail role-playing title for macOS that plunges players into a grim post-apocalyptic landscape. As a modern follow-up to the 1988 original, it combines a layered storyline with strategic, party-based gameplay and extensive world exploration.
Standout Elements
- Tactical, turn-based encounters that reward careful positioning and planning.
- A dense, choice-driven narrative where decisions produce lasting consequences.
- An expansive game world populated by varied characters, side missions, and environmental storytelling.
Character Progression and Player Decisions
Players can build and tailor their squad with a wide range of skills, perks, and equipment. Those customization options feed directly into how situations unfold: dialogue outcomes, quest paths, and even the state of locations can shift based on choices made throughout the campaign.
Combat Mechanics and Narrative Systems
The title blends methodical combat with a robust conversation engine. Combat is turn-based and favors tactical thinking, while the dialogue system supports multiple approaches to encounters—negotiation, stealth, or confrontation—letting player agency shape both short-term outcomes and the broader plot.
Atmosphere and Challenges
Exploration presents moral quandaries and survival-focused obstacles in a richly detailed setting. The game’s tone and worldbuilding create an immersive, often stark atmosphere that complements the strategic demands of the gameplay.
